Vulnerability Description
This issue was addressed with improved access restrictions. This issue is fixed in Safari 26.5, iOS 18.7.9 and iPadOS 18.7.9, iOS 26.5 and iPadOS 26.5, macOS Tahoe 26.5, visionOS 26.5. Processing maliciously crafted web content may disclose sensitive user information.
CVSS Score
HIGH
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Apple | Ipados | < 18.7.9 |
| Apple | Iphone Os | < 18.7.9 |
| Apple | Macos | >= 26.0, < 26.5 |
| Apple | Visionos | < 26.5 |
